Four Maryland nonprofits receive funding to build low-income solar

  |   Solar, solar industry

The Maryland Energy Administration (MEA) announced $1.5 million in awards to build new solar on low-income Marylanders’ primary residence. Funding for this project is made possible through MEA’s Low Income Solar Grant Program, which is funded by the Strategic Energy Investment Fund. “Through this program, MEA continues to remain committed to making solar energy accessible…
